Effect of plant growth substances on yield, quality and economics of golden rod (Solidago canadensis L.)

International Journal of Research in Agronomy · 2025 · Vol. 8(11) · pp. 86–88

Abstract

Effect of plant growth substances on yield and quality of golden rod (Solidago Canadensis L.) experiment was carried out during March 2022 to November 2022 at College Farm, College of Horticulture, SDAU, Jagudan, Gujarat. The experiment was comprised of two factors time of spray with three levels viz., T1 (30 DAT), T2 (45 DAT) and T3 (30 and 45 DAT) and plant growth substances with six levels. viz., p1(GA3 @ 100 ppm), p2(GA3 @ 150 ppm), p3 (Triacontanol @ 20 ppm), p4 (Triacontanol @ 30 ppm), p5 (CCC @ 500 ppm), p6 (CCC @ 1000 ppm). T2 (Spray at 30 DAT + GA3 @ 150 ppm) found superior on yield and quality parameters viz., number of panicle per plant, number of panicle per plot, number of panicle per hectare, vase life of panicle and longevity of panicles on plant.
